What is Specification Management?
Specification management refers to the systematic process of creating, organizing, maintaining and updating project specifications. It involves ensuring that all internal and external stakeholders—from architects and engineers to contractors and suppliers—have access to the most up-to-date, accurate and consistent specifications.
Project specifications document a range of elements, including:
- Materials: Specifications define the specific products to use in construction, including detailed requirements for quality, performance, sustainability and compliance with project standards. Specifications may also include sustainable materials that meet environmental standards and contribute to the project's sustainability.
- Standards and Codes: Regulatory requirements and industry standards the project must meet, ensuring compliance and mini mizing legal or safety risks.
- Performance Criteria: The expected performance or functional requirements of the materials or systems, including production methods that ensure quality, efficiency and consistency in the manufacturing or assembly. These criteria help define the standards for materials and systems performing under specific conditions.
- Installation Requirements: This includes the methods and processes for installing materials and systems, including guidelines for using sustainable materials that minimize environmental impact and enhance project sustainability.
Specification management ensures these requirements are clearly defined, organized and communicated to all team members, preventing misunderstandings that could lead to costly mistakes.

Why is Specification Management Important?
Effective specification management is critical for several reasons:
1. Prevents Mistakes and Miscommunication
Specifications provide the necessary clarity for every aspect of a project. Without clear, consistent specifications, there is room for misinterpretation, leading to procurement, construction and installation errors. A robust specification management system gives all project participants a single source of truth, reducing the risk of miscommunication and rework.
2. Ensures Compliance with Regulations
Every construction project must comply with industry standards, environmental regulations and other requirements. 3. Improves Cost Control
Accurate specifications ensure that the right materials are purchased and used, which helps prevent overspending on incorrect or unnecessary items. Specification management also minimizes the need for costly changes or rework during construction, helping projects stay on budget by avoiding errors and inconsistencies.
4. Facilitates Efficient Project Execution
Well-organized and up-to-date specifications enable construction teams to confidently execute tasks, understanding client expectations and how to proceed. Specification management tools provide easy access to project documentation, ensuring the correct version of each document is always available. Access to current documents increases productivity, reduces downtime and improves workflow across project teams.
5. Ensures Compliance
Quality control in specification management ensures that all project requirements meet the highest standards and are achievable. By carefully reviewing specifications for compliance with industry standards and regulations, teams can catch potential issues early, such as incorrect materials or performance gaps. This proactive approach minimizes errors, ensures regulatory compliance and helps deliver a project that meets quality and safety expectations.
6. Enhances Collaboration
Modern specification management systems allow for real-time updates and shared access, facilitating better communication and collaboration across internal teams. With clear and accessible project specifications, all stakeholders—designers, contractors, suppliers and clients—are aligned on the project's goals and requirements, which leads to smoother project execution and higher customer satisfaction. This transparency and alignment help ensure the project meets functional expectations and the client's needs.
Best Practices for Effective Specification Management
Managing project specifications requires careful attention to detail, organization and the right tools. Here are some best practices for optimizing specification management:
1. Use a Centralized Specification Repository
Using a centralized, cloud-based specification management software ensures everyone can access the most current version of the specifications. Built-in approval workflows streamline the process, making it easy for all stakeholders—architects and engineers—to access, review, approve and update the specifications in real time. One key feature helps track document versions and monitor specification changes over time, with built-in workflows ensuring teams use only current information and adequately review and approve all updates.
2. Implement Version Control
Specifications can change during a project due to design revisions, regulatory updates, or unforeseen challenges. Version control ensures that every change is tracked in your specification management process, so stakeholders always work from the most recent document version. It also allows teams to revert to earlier versions if needed, reducing the risk of mistakes due to outdated information.

4. Regularly Review and Update Specifications
Specifications should be reviewed periodically by internal and external stakeholders throughout the project lifecycle to ensure that they remain relevant and accurate, providing complete control over the project's direction. Regular audits help ensure the specifications meet project goals, regulatory standards and evolving design requirements, maintaining consistent quality throughout. This proactive approach minimizes risks, enhances decision-making and keeps the project on track.
5. Collaborate and Communicate with Stakeholders
Collaboration is key to effective specification management. Regular meetings or check-ins with stakeholders (designers, contractors, suppliers and clients) help ensure everyone is on the same page. Collaboration tools enable real-time communication about changes, updates and challenges, essential to prevent misunderstandings or conflicts later in the project.
